The Siemens SENTRON 3VA2163-5MN36-0JL0 is a 3-pole molded case circuit breaker (MCCB) rated for 63 A continuous current, built around the ETU350M electronic overcurrent release. It is the motor-protection variant of the 3VA2 frame, meaning the trip curve and release logic are tailored for motor starting inrush and thermal overload — not for general distribution. The 187 kA breaking capacity at 240 V (121 kA at 415 V) gives it the interrupting capability for high-fault installations, typically transformer secondaries or large motor control centers where SCCR demands exceed what a standard MCB can clear.
Current ratings and thermal derating
Rated continuous current Iu is 63 A, and it holds that rating from 40 °C up to 50 °C ambient. Above that, the ETU350M release derates: 60.48 A at 55 °C, 59.22 A at 60 °C, 57.96 A at 65 °C, and 56.7 A at 70 °C. In a sealed, uncooled enclosure — typical for motor control centers in hot plant environments — that derating matters. The maximum power loss is 75 W, which drives internal cabinet heating and must be factored into the thermal budget if multiple breakers are ganged.
Trip unit and protection features
The ETU350M is a microprocessor-based release providing adjustable overload (Ir), short-time (Isd), and instantaneous (Ii) protection, plus ground-fault alarm (not trip — this unit ships without ground-fault monitoring). Phase failure detection is included, which is critical for motor protection: losing one phase on a running motor draws locked-rotor current on the remaining phases, and the release catches that imbalance. The breaker also carries a shunt trip (STL) auxiliary release for remote tripping, plus a 2+2 auxiliary contact block (2 auxiliary switches + 1 trip alarm + 1 electrical alarm switch HQ). No undervoltage release or communication module is fitted on this variant.
Physical dimensions and panel fit
The breaker measures 181 mm high × 105 mm wide × 86 mm deep. The 105 mm width is the standard 3-pole 3VA2 frame footprint — it occupies three 35 mm DIN-module positions if panel-mounted, or bolts directly onto a mounting plate. Depth of 86 mm includes the rotary handle and arc-chamber protrusion; clearance behind the panel for the rear terminals should allow at least 100 mm for cable bending radius. Operating temperature range is −25 °C to 70 °C; storage range extends from −40 °C to 80 °C.
